What is Benjamin Hornigold EV-to-FCF?

Benjamin Hornigold ASX:BHD 30 EV-to-FCF is 21.92 as of Aug. 25, 2026. GuruFocus rates ASX:BHD with a GF Score™ of 30/100. The stock has 2 warning signs investors should review. Among 945 Asset Management companies, Benjamin Hornigold ranks worse than 64.97% on this metric.

EV-to-FCF is calculated as enterprise value divided by its free cash flow. As of today, Benjamin Hornigold's Enterprise Value is A$2.85 Mil. Benjamin Hornigold's Free Cash Flow for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2025 was A$0.13 Mil. Therefore, Benjamin Hornigold's EV-to-FCF for today is 21.92.

Enterprise Value is used because it is a more complete measure in reflecting how much an investor pays when buying a company. Free Cash Flow is an important financial metric because it represents the actual amount of cash at a company's disposal. Companies with a low EV-to-FCF ratio, combined with a strong balance sheet are generally considered as undervalued.

Benjamin Hornigold Business Description

Address 133-145 Castlereagh Street, Suite 20.01, Level 20, Sydney, NSW, AUS, 2000
Benjamin Hornigold Ltd is an investment company. Its investment objective is to achieve moderate to high portfolio returns over the medium to long term. The company's investment portfolio is invested in a small number of high-conviction investments in undervalued assets, which provide growth opportunities to achieve above-average returns (whilst limiting volatility) over the medium to long term. It derives revenue from trading on financial instruments. The company operates in a single segment that relates to financial services, and has only one geographical segment, which is Australia.
